Do-it-yourself (DIY) projects are a great way for homeowners and DIY enthusiasts to save money and gain satisfaction from completing a project themselves. Fixing the roof of your house is no exception, as it can be a complex task that requires attention to detail. In this article, we’ll go over some important tips to consider when tackling this task so you can ensure the job is done safely and correctly.

Determine if you have the skill set necessary to complete the project

It is essential to determine if you have the skill set necessary to fix a house roof, as it can be dangerous and difficult for those new to DIY projects. You can always hire a roofing contractor to do the job for you if you feel it is beyond your abilities. When undertaking such a task, you must possess the relevant knowledge and experience to do so safely and effectively. Lacking these skills can lead to further damage or even injury.

It is also essential to consider whether or not you have access to all the necessary tools for completing the job correctly, as well as any additional help that may be needed from others with more expertise. Taking the time to assess your abilities accurately and honestly will ensure a smoother process when attempting DIY projects, especially home repairs like fixing a house roof. Inspect the roof and determine what repairs need to be done

Inspecting the roof is an essential part of properly fixing a house roof. It can help identify any potential issues with the roof that may need to be addressed, such as missing shingles or cracks in the support structure. A thorough inspection will ensure that any necessary repairs are done correctly and efficiently, helping to save time and money in both short-term and long-term costs. Additionally, inspecting the roof regularly can help prevent further damage from occurring due to lack of maintenance or neglect. By inspecting the roof, DIY enthusiasts can better understand what repairs need to be done and how best to do them. These steps will ensure that your house’s roof remains safe and secure for years to come.

Take exact measurements of the roof

Taking accurate roof measurements is critical when planning any roofing project. With exact dimensions, you know how much material will be needed, whether the roof can bear the load of new materials, or even what kind of repairs are necessary in the first place. Taking exact measurements helps DIY enthusiasts create an accurate budget and plan for their project, saving them time and money in the long run. Additionally, measuring ensures that all materials used fit properly and securely on the roof, reducing potential issues from leaking seams or loose components down the line. Lastly, precise measurements allow you to order custom-sized materials if needed; otherwise, you may face costly returns for incorrectly sized items.

Apply a generous amount of sealant

Sealing the roof of your house is an important step for proper maintenance throughout the years. It shields it from water damage and prevents leakages, which can be quite costly if left unchecked. Applying a generous amount of sealant helps to create a tight seal that keeps moisture out and ensures that your roof will last for many more years. DIY enthusiasts should take this seriously when fixing their roofs because insufficient sealant means there are still gaps in between, which could weaken the final product. So remember, apply a generous amount of sealant when fixing your house’s roof so you can rest assured knowing it’s secure and weatherproof!

Make sure you have all the proper safety equipment

One of the most important tips for any DIY enthusiast is to ensure that they have all the proper safety equipment before attempting to fix their roof. This includes hard hats, safety glasses, harnesses and lanyards, protective clothing and footwear, gloves, and anything else that could help protect you from potential hazards. Taking the time to invest in quality safety gear can save you from severe injury or worse situations should an accident occur while working on your roof. It’s also important to check that your safety gear fits properly so it won’t become a distraction or cause more harm than good. Don’t work on your roof without having all the safety equipment at hand!
